On Mon, 2022-05-09 at 21:49 +0500, Muhmud Ahmad wrote:
> Is there a script available to convert the documentation to epub?

I have used https://github.com/jlhg/texinfo2epub in the past. It's
transforming directly from docbook to epub so it should give you a
pretty decent result.
